Down with the fitness

Maxi-pad aka Juice Box aka Snacks-a-million will be visiting me for the next three weeks starting today. As the dude has gone off and pre-enlisted in the US Marine Corp he has learned that he is a little behind the curve in his fitness. And body weight.


So this guy is gonna need some Hans and Franz treatment to get "pumped up" as much as he can within his genetic ability. Hard to be buff when your dad is skinny. Curse you Gregor Mendel!

What this means is that I too have then be on this type of program while he is here. So I should have a very tiring three weeks as well. But will hopefully also come out the other end of it a little fitter than I am now. But I'm hoping to not gain any weight.

I've beefed up the amount of protein supplements I have around and other meal replacement choices. I have signed us up for swimming twice a week for the three weeks. I also plan to do running 4 days a week and weights with him 3 days a week. All this on top of the just regular fun summer things we have planned.

Kid's gonna be hurting! Hhahaha, but it will be worth it. I already looked up the requierments for his initial strength test and we might do a before and after just to see how far he's come during the 3 week visit.
